学堂 学堂 学堂公众号手机端

如何设置云VPS实现自动拨号切换IP?

lewis 11个月前 (06-24) 阅读数 773 #云服务器

在网络技术飞速发展的今天,很多用户选择使用云VPS进行各种在线操作。然而,有时候因为某些特定需求,我们需要频繁更换IP地址。那么,如何在云VPS上设置自动拨号切换IP呢?本文将为你详细解答。

一、准备工作

首先,你需要确保你的云VPS已经安装了操作系统,并且拥有root权限。同时,你还需要准备一个可以提供动态IP的拨号网络服务。

二、安装拨号软件

在大多数Linux系统中,我们可以使用wvdialpppd等软件进行拨号。以wvdial为例,你可以使用以下命令进行安装:

sudo apt-get install wvdial

三、配置拨号脚本

安装完成后,我们需要创建一个拨号脚本,以便自动执行拨号操作。你可以使用任何文本编辑器创建一个新的脚本文件,例如autodial.sh,并在其中添加以下内容:

#!/bin/bash
while true
do
    wvdial s1 && sleep 60 && poff
done

这个脚本将会每60秒执行一次拨号操作,并在拨号成功后断开连接。你可以根据需要调整时间间隔。

四、设置定时任务

为了确保脚本能够在系统启动时自动运行,我们需要将其设置为定时任务。你可以使用crontab命令编辑定时任务:

crontab -e

然后在打开的编辑器中添加以下内容:

@reboot /path/to/your/autodial.sh

这样,每次系统启动时,都会自动执行你的拨号脚本。

五、测试与优化

完成以上步骤后,重启你的云VPS,然后观察是否能够成功拨号并切换IP。如果遇到问题,你可能需要检查你的拨号网络服务是否正常,或者调整脚本中的参数。

此外,你还可以考虑加入一些错误处理机制,例如在拨号失败时发送邮件通知等,以便及时发现并解决问题。

总的来说,通过以上步骤,你就可以在云VPS上实现自动拨号切换IP了。这不仅可以提高你的网络灵活性,还可以满足一些特定的网络需求。希望本文对你有所帮助!

版权声明

本文仅代表作者观点,不代表博信信息网立场。

热门